Exquisite Dining: Michelin Star Restaurants in NYC

New York City, the culinary capital of the world, is home to some of the finest Michelin star restaurants that offer exquisite dining experiences. The Michelin Guide, a respected international guidebook, awards stars to restaurants that meet their criteria for excellence in food, ambiance, and service. Let us take a look at some of the… Continue reading Exquisite Dining: Michelin Star Restaurants in NYC